Understanding the Role of a Consultant Psychiatrist
A consultant psychiatrist is a medical doctor who focuses on the diagnosis and treatment of mental health conditions. They are trained to assess and handle a large variety of conditions, including depression, stress and anxiety, bipolar affective disorder, schizophrenia, and more. Consultant psychiatrists can prescribe medications, offer psychiatric therapy, and coordinate care with other mental health specialists.

1. What is the difference between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?
A psychiatrist is a medical physician who can recommend medications and has a medical degree. A psychologist, on the other hand, typically has a postgraduate degree in psychology and focuses on psychotherapy and behavioral interventions.
2. How do I understand if I need to see a psychiatrist?
If you are experiencing persistent signs of a mental health condition, such as serious depression, stress and anxiety, or mood swings, it might be helpful to see a psychiatrist. They can offer a medical diagnosis and recommend proper treatment alternatives.
3. Will my insurance cover psychiatric services?
Numerous insurance coverage strategies cover psychiatric services, however coverage can differ. Talk to your insurance provider to understand what is covered, any copayments or deductibles, and how to find in-network suppliers.
4. What can I anticipate throughout my first appointment?
The first appointment generally includes an extensive evaluation, including a conversation of your signs, case history, and any previous treatments. The psychiatrist will utilize this details to diagnose your condition and establish a treatment strategy.
5. How typically will I require to see a psychiatrist?
The frequency of visits depends on your specific requirements and the treatment plan. Initially, you might have more frequent appointments to monitor your reaction to medication and therapy. Gradually, these consultations might end up being less regular.
6. Can a psychiatrist help with addiction?
Yes, lots of psychiatrists have proficiency in dealing with dependency and can offer medication-assisted treatment and therapy to support healing.
7. What if I do not feel comfortable with my psychiatrist?
If you don't feel comfortable or don't see improvement, it's essential to interact your concerns. If necessary, seek a consultation or find a new psychiatrist. The ideal fit is crucial for efficient treatment.Steps to Take After Locating a Consultant Psychiatrist
